数据蛙数据分析每周作业

查看DataFrame中column值具体有哪些:drop_du

2020-10-13  本文已影响0人  我住永安当

1、drop_duplicates()

DataFrame.drop_duplicates(subset=None, keep='first', inplace=False)
data = pd.DataFrame({'A':['a','b','c','c'],'B':[1,1,2,2]})
print(data.A.drop_duplicates(keep='first'))
print(data.A.drop_duplicates(keep='last'))
print(data.A.drop_duplicates(keep=False))
image.png

此处不讨论其删除重复值的用法。

2、nunique()

如果只需要剔除重复值后,column中的值有哪几种,就可以使用nunique()


image.png

可以看到,A列的值有abc3个,所以这里返回3.

3、unique()

如果需要看到提出重复值后,columns中的值有哪几种,还可以使用unique()。


image.png

4、value_counts()

该函数可以对Series里面的每个值进行计数并且排序。


image.png

需要注意的是,如果有np.NaN,只有drop_duplicates()unique()可以予以显示。

image.png
上一篇下一篇

猜你喜欢

热点阅读